Republican Club of Central Pasco Meeting, With Guest Speaker Dr. Paula O’ Neil, at Copperstone Executive Suites
The Republican Club of Central Pasco held its monthly meeting on Monday, March 27, 2017, from 6:30pm to 7:30pm, located at Copperstone Executive Suites, 3632 Land O' Lakes Blvd, Land O’ Lakes, FL 34639.
The Guest Speaker was: Dr. Paula O’ Neil, the first woman to be elected Clerk of Court in Pasco. In honor of Women’s History Month she presented the story of Susan B. Anthony, and the suffrage movement that began the push for the 19th Amendment and the woman’s right to vote.
Accompanying Dr. Paula on her presentation of the History of Women in politics and government was: Denise Kavanaugh, the first female on the B.A.T. Mobile Breathalyzer Unit.
About Republican Club of Central Pasco:
The Republican Club of Central Pasco is an active political Club that works with the State Republican Party and the Pasco Republican Executive Committee to help support and elect local, state, and federal Republican candidates.
Club members are a lively group of people who believe in the core Republican principles of limited government, fiscal responsibility, low taxes, and strong national defense, and the rule of law and our Constitution.
